WWC differentiates itself as a source of capital that understands
the needs of growth stage investments. We define growth stage as
the phase in a company’s development when it has been successful
in introducing a product to a market and demonstrating there is
interest in the product from its customers, but the dimensions of
the market are still in question and the company’s products
need further development. Capital is frequently needed at this stage
and WWC stands ready to help with the capital and other needs as
required.
WWC generally does not invest in the following:
- Companies that are in the start-up phase of development
- Companies that have not achieved $1 million of sales volume
- Companies that require large amounts of capital to achieve
a positive cash flow
- Industry sectors that are outside our knowledge level including
biotechnology, semiconductors, and materials research.
